I'm trying to set up the Intel SCS on Windows Server 2003. Is it possible to use an external Microsoft CA, instead of installing on the local server. If so, does anybody know how to go about this?

You can certainly use an external MS CA. Please make sure that the CA is accessible to the SCS machine. If web enrollment for the CA is enabled, all certificates can be requested using web (http://CA-IP/certsrv). Please let us know if you haveother questions.
